Basement cement pouring services involve the careful preparation and placement of concrete to create a solid, durable foundation for basement floors. This process typically begins with site assessment and preparation, ensuring the area is properly leveled and free of debris. Once ready, contractors will pour and finish the concrete to achieve a smooth, even surface that meets structural and aesthetic standards. Proper curing and finishing techniques are used to enhance the longevity of the basement floor, making it suitable for various uses such as storage, recreation, or additional living space.
This service addresses common problems such as cracks, uneven surfaces, and moisture issues that can compromise a basement’s integrity over time. An improperly poured or finished concrete slab may develop cracks or settle unevenly, leading to potential water infiltration and damage to property. By opting for professional basement cement pouring, homeowners can prevent these issues and ensure a stable, level surface that supports the overall safety and usability of the space. This is especially important in areas prone to ground movement or moisture, where a well-constructed foundation can significantly extend the life of the basement.

The overview below groups typical Basement Cement Pouring proj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sacramento,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or basement cement pouring projects, such as patching or small sections,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ope and materials used.
Standard Basement Pouring - For standard basement slabs or foundation pours, local contractors often charge between $1,200 and $3,500. Larger or more detailed projects tend to approach the higher end of this range.
Full Basement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of an existing basement floor can cost between $4,000 and $8,000, with some complex or larger projects reaching higher prices. These jobs are less common but necessary for extensive renovations.
Larger, Complex Projects - Very large or intricate basement cement pours, such as those requiring extensive reinforcement or custom work, can exceed $10,000, though such projects are less frequent and vary widely based on specific needs and site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of pouring a new basement cement slab? A new cement slab can improve basement stability, create a smooth surface for finishing, and help prevent moisture issues.
How do contractors prepare the basement before pouring cement? They typically clear the area, set up formwork, install reinforcement, and ensure proper drainage and moisture barriers are in place.
What types of cement mixes are suitable for basement pouring? Contractors often use standard concrete mixes designed for foundation work, which may include additives for durability and moisture resistance.
Can existing basement floors be resurfaced or repaired? Yes, local service providers can resurface or repair existing concrete to address cracks, unevenness, or surface deterioration.
What factors influence the quality of a basement cement pour? Proper site preparation, quality materials, reinforcement placement, and skilled workmanship are key factors that impact the finished result.
